Cashier applicants have rated the interview process at TJ Maxx with 1.9 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 76% positive. To compare, the company-average is 73.2%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Cashier roles take an average of 9 days to get hired, when considering 72 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at TJ Maxx overall takes an average of 11 days.
Common stages of the interview process at TJ Maxx as a Cashier according to 72 Glassdoor interviews include:
One on one interview: 35%
Background check: 14%
Drug test: 10%
Skills test: 9%
Presentation: 8%
Personality test: 7%
IQ intelligence test: 6%
Group panel interview: 5%
Phone interview: 3%
Other: 3%
